EXCEL VBA 启动其它应用程序问题

EXCEL VBA 启动其它应用程序问题,第1张

Shell "yourPath\BarTenderEXE", vbNormalFocus

'yourPath是exe的绝对路径

'以上是打开BarTenderEXE的命令

接下来还要自动打印就比较麻烦,如果你对命令行比较熟练那可以继续往下看,如果不是那就请到这里吧,打开D:\TMBTW之后请人手 *** 作打印吧。

后面我不知道BarTenderEXE是具体怎么 *** 作。。。所以大概可以这样:

一般具备打印功能的exe文件,需要打开文件(条码文件),大概在file - open 里面,然后打印是file-print(一般快捷键ctrl+p)

那么就简单了,打开了BarTenderEXE之后,接着发送键盘指令

alt - down - enter - 输入“D:\TMBTW” - enter - alt - down - p - enter

Dim wb As Workbook

ApplicationScreenUpdating = False

Set wb = WorkbooksOpen(要调用的工作薄的路径及名称)

‘路径及名称格式如下 ThisWorkbookPath & "\Backxlsx")

With wbSheets("表名 不是工作薄名")range(要调用的单元格)

对调用单无格的 *** 作

End With

wbClose 1

ApplicationScreenUpdating = True

以上就是关于EXCEL VBA 启动其它应用程序问题全部的内容,包括:EXCEL VBA 启动其它应用程序问题、VBA编程中如何调用其他文件夹下工作簿里的数据、等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/zz/10132906.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-05
下一篇 2023-05-05

发表评论

登录后才能评论

评论列表(0条)

保存